# License Information ## Source Data (All Public Domain or Public Access) ### U.S. Census Bureau - American Community Survey (ACS) 2022 - Veteran population estimates - Public domain (U.S. Government work) ### RAND Corporation - State-level firearm ownership estimates (2016) - Published research, publicly available - URL: rand.org/research/gun-policy ###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ives (ATF) - Federal Firearms Licensee (FFL) counts (2023) - Public domain (U.S. Government work) ###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) - WONDER database: Underlying Cause of Death - Veteran and civilian suicide rates (2021) - Public domain (U.S. Government work) ### U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) - PTSD prevalence and VA healthcare utilization (2022) - Public domain (U.S. Government work) ### U.S. Department of Defense (DoD) - Defense Manpower Data Center (DMDC) - Active duty personnel and economic impact (2023) - Public domain (U.S. Government work) ## Combined Dataset This compiled dataset is released under **CC-BY-4.0**.
